‘A Peaceful Solution’ is the beautiful, inspiring song written by Willie and daughter Amy Nelson. They have both recorded the song, and you can listen to their versions of the song at http://WillieNelsonPRI.com. Willie has recorded several versions — reggae, gypsy-jazzy, country, with his band, and acapella. And beyond that, they have offered this song, graciously, to anyone who feels inspired to sing and record it.  You can find out how you can submit your version at the website.Â
